...this thread is for those who are procrastinating (as I was) about switching from 7 to 10. Linux switch is another issue.

The switch to Linux is most definitely one of the options for those who are procrastinating about what to do about the end of Windows 7 support.

There are maybe eight computing devices in my house. Some are running 7 and some are now running 10. After having looked at 10 and having read up on the fundamental differences between 7 and 10, I determined that 10 is NOT the way I want to go with my primary devices, all of which are on Windows 7.

I had been dreading the prospect of having to learn how to build my own OS from all of the building blocks available from Linux, until Freeper Openurmind turned me on to the new generation of Linux versions, which are pre-built, and basically install like any Windows operating system.

We installed Linux Mint (Cinnamon) on one of my older laptops, side by side with the existing Windows 7 system. I've got to tell you, the install is smooth and painless. Just follow the prompts and in very little time you'll have a new operating system on your computer that has about 80% similarity to your Microsoft system. You can even make it look exactly like Windows 7 if you wish.

I'd advise anyone facing this dilemma to check out videos on YouTube to see what Linux looks like, and what the advantages are (there are many).

Biggest problem is getting photos from I phone and camera onto the computer.

I think I see your problem here. It's the "I" before phone. We're an Android family (Samsung to be precise) and I have NEVER experienced problems transferring files from phones to computers and back using nothing more than Windows Explorer. I was even able to use Win Explorer the other night to move files on my wife's phone from her phone storage to her card storage.

And that's using computers running Win 7, 8.1 when I had it and now 10. Different versions, same results.
